As of Jan. 1, the price of a standard STM monthly pass will rise from $77 to $79.50.
# w$ X2 Q/ A3 l9 _2 XA weekly pass will go up from $23.75 to $24.50.
9 `% I7 w2 w* a- h9 c* YA ticket to get on the 747 bus from downtown Montreal to the airport will go up a dollar — from $9 to $10.8 X4 A0 S# F. p$ s
For students and seniors, the price of a monthly pass will go from $45 to $47.50./ M6 h* L9 Y* l- [
The price of a single fare remains unchanged at $3.; z7 H+ _5 p. }% Z1 a5 p, T4 R

Vice-chair of the STM Marvin Rotrand says Montrealers are still getting a good deal.
, P7 I J4 L# |* j" @" k# A0 r5 ^8 S" n$ ^1 J& C# U+ a
3 c. O0 H9 {2 D5 I# ]“"We will remain among the lowest fares in North America and the lowest of the major networks in Quebec," Rotrand said.& l' J% X3 Y$ n9 I
" M% L- v2 L9 T* y
STM officials say the fare hikes are necessary to make up for a $16-million budget shortfall.
: ` U& x3 N4 [4 U6 U) N9 D( P: [% R/ M* |7 L1 D
But the opposition party Projet Montréal is worried the hikes are too significant, and will dissuade Montrealers from using public transit.9 f" G g6 O9 e; a" z6 N8 f
: {: x+ `3 B0 c
“It's a little bit too much for us. In our opinion, we should not raise STM fees higher than inflation," said Projet Montréal councillor Craig Sauvé.# N' E2 F- Q) y, A6 D9 v7 g
) o7 a: `( k l7 J" PService cuts too?2 G( |& I" [+ Y# r! x' E4 u$ G/ t
STM officials say they still don’t know how much money the public transit corporation will get from the city of Montreal — the city has delayed releasing its 2014 budget until February.
; ]( d- U, p( J% L7 B4 C x }Rotrand says if the STM doesn't get the increase it asked for, it may have to cut services in addition to increasing its fees.% t, D- T* f+ q2 |' l2 D4 z% V( T
